在Unix环境下进行Python开发,合理配置系统环境可以显著提升开发效率。•确保安装了最新版本的Python和pip,这能保证代码兼容性和安全性。
使用虚拟环境是管理依赖的推荐方式。通过venv或conda创建隔离的环境,避免全局包冲突,让项目更易维护。
安装高效的文本编辑器或IDE,如VS Code或PyCharm,配合Unix下的终端工具,可以实现快速编码与调试。
熟悉Unix命令行工具,如grep、find、sed等,能帮助开发者高效处理文件和日志,节省大量时间。
配置SSH密钥登录,减少密码输入,提高远程服务器操作的便捷性。同时,使用tmux或screen可以保持长时间运行的进程。
定期清理无用的包和缓存,使用pip cache clean和rm -rf ~/.cache/pip等命令保持环境整洁。
AI绘图结果,仅供参考
利用Unix的管道和重定向功能,将多个命令组合使用,实现自动化任务处理,提升工作效率。